Latest Patents
Mark Chaisson's latest patents demonstrate his commitment to improving analytical methods. One significant invention is the "Real-time analytical methods and systems," which focuses on compositions, methods, and systems for conducting single-molecule, real-time analysis of various biological reactions. This invention not only provides insights into these reactions but also allows for the identification of factors that can influence them, enhancing our ability to stimulate, enhance, or inhibit such processes.
Another key patent is for "Sequence assembly and consensus sequence determination," which pertains to computer-implemented methods and systems that process signal data from analytical operations. This invention focuses on analyzing nucleotide sequences from nucleic acids, facilitating de novo assembly and consensus sequence determination of genomes or genetic fragments.
Career Highlights
Mark Chaisson is currently employed at Pacific Biosciences of California, Inc., a company known for its innovative contributions to biotechnology and genomic analysis. His work there not only reflects his innovative spirit but also his dedication to pushing the boundaries of biological research.
